- 1st February 2012Two parallel lines are crossed by a straight line. One of a pair of co-interior (allied) angles is 70°. Work out the other.
- 2nd February 2012Here are seven numbers: 11, 13, 5, 8, 14, 7, 25. Work out the median and the range.
- 3rd February 2012A pie chart shows 24 people. 22 of them chose science. Work out the angle of that sector.
- 4th February 2012A length x is 15 cm, rounded to the nearest whole number. Write down the error interval for x.
- 5th February 2012Solve the inequality 7x - 1 < 104.
- 6th February 2012A recipe for 10 pancakes uses 390 g of flour. How much flour is needed for 9 pancakes?
- 7th February 2012Two of the angles in a triangle are 56° and 89°. Work out the third angle.
- 8th February 2012A bag holds 9 red, 7 blue and 9 green counters. One is taken at random. Work out the probability it is green.
- 9th February 2012190 students were asked how they travel. 30 walked, and of those 15 were late. How many walkers were on time?
- 10th February 2012Between which two consecutive whole numbers does sqrt(157) lie?
- 11th February 2012Simplify 7a + 9b + 3a - 2b.
- 12th February 20127 identical pens cost £11.55. Work out the cost of 3 of the same pens.
- 13th February 2012A goat is tied to a post in an open field by a rope 4 m long. Describe the region of grass it can reach.
- 14th February 2012A biased coin lands on heads with probability 0.1. It is thrown 100 times. How many heads would you expect?
- 15th February 2012On a bar chart each gridline square stands for 4 people. A bar is 3 squares tall. How many people does it show?
- 16th February 2012Work out 4/5 x 1/2. Give your answer in its simplest form.
- 17th February 2012A line has equation y = 3x - 3. Write down where it crosses the x-axis and where it crosses the y-axis.
- 18th February 2012A model of an aircraft is built to a scale of 1 : 20. The real length is 0.4 m. How long is the model, in cm?
- 19th February 2012An L-shape is a 20 cm by 11 cm rectangle with a 4 cm by 3 cm rectangle cut out of one corner. Work out its area.
- 20th February 2012Freya has 4 scores with a mean of 8. Scores 9, 6, 7 are known. Work out the missing score.
- 21st February 2012A stem and leaf diagram has a single stem 5 with the leaves 0, 2, 3, 6, 9. Work out the median of the five values.
- 22nd February 2012A length x is 62 cm, rounded to the nearest whole number. Write down the error interval for x.
- 23rd February 2012The angles in a triangle are 2x°, x° and (x + 92)°. Form an equation and work out x.
- 24th February 2012A 300 g bag of rice costs £3.00. Work out the cost per 100 g.
- 25th February 2012A cuboid measures 10 cm by 2 cm by 6 cm. Work out its total surface area.
- 26th February 2012The probability that it rains tomorrow is 2/5. Work out the probability that it does not rain.
- 27th February 2012A pie chart shows 36 items. One sector has an angle of 60°. How many items does it represent?
- 28th February 2012Between which two consecutive whole numbers does sqrt(191) lie?
- 29th February 2012A rectangle is x cm wide and 9 cm longer than it is wide. Write a simplified expression for its perimeter.
